Known for their stylish design and reliable performance, Smeg electric hobs are a popular choice for many households. However, like any appliance, they can occasionally encounter faults that need attention.

Some common issues that may arise with Smeg electric hobs include overheating, incorrect temperature settings, and error codes such as E1, E2, or E3. These codes can indicate various problems ranging from sensor malfunctions to wiring issues. Not Heating Properly

Failed element, control switch, or wiring fault.

Controls Not Responding

Touch panel/PCB failure.

Cracked Glass Surface

Impact damage — glass replacement required.

Uneven/Intermittent Heating

Sensor or protection cut-out issues.

Error Codes

Sensor or power supply faults.
